Berry’ Phase In The Degenerate Parametric Amplifier

We discuss the manifestation of Berry’s phase in the degenerate parametric amplifier of quantum optics. Mainly we derive the Berry phase in the simplest case when the phase of the classical pump field varies adiabatically. Also we show that the effect of the phase may be discerned at all times in the photon-counting statistics of the output field.The main contents of this paper are as follows:first, we introduce the background of Berry phase as well as the significance of this research, and give a brief account of the structure of the paper. Then, the theory of the quantized adiabatic approximations is stated here, only by which can Berry phase be calculated. At the same time, we take a further step to contrast the new adiabatic approximations with the classical adiabatic approximations, which shows up some weaknesses of the latter and more importantly, some strengths of the former. Next, we give a brief introduction to Berry Topology phase as well as the calculation process of its basic theory. We also try to explore how to work out Berry Geometric phase under the precondition of the classical adiabatic approximations. Finally, we come to the conclusion and are hopeful for the prospects.
